      My PB came on a modified 1/8 booyah spinnerbait, March 1st this year in the creek,mid channel.off the edge of buck bass bedding. I cought it on a medium rod w 8lb braid, she weighed 6lb 7oz.thx Steve! I've always got better fish mid day,and would even sleep in,and show up hrs after my buddy did,and he was shocked...that it happened. And shocked by the small profile I cought it on.all myths need to be scienced out personally, to get the best results. If it's dead calm a small bait has less splash entering the water. If it's a big bait toss it on the bank,and slide it in to the water slowly,and present it stealthy.or even long line it behind the boat through key choke points,around hvy cover.and fish those edges where 2 things come together, shell rock to grass,or drop offs,channel swings,or humps.all have gotten me hawgs throughout the season.
